Calling for Community Action: New Bus Route Proposed in Gauteng
In a refreshing call to action, Refiloe Nt’sekhe, a prominent member of the Gauteng Provincial Legislature and resident of Norkem Park, has rallied the community to support the introduction of a new bus route that would connect Birchleigh and Norkem Park to Rhodesfield. Currently, residents commuting to the busy Johannesburg Central Business District (CBD) face limited travel options, making this proposed route not just timely but essential for enhancing accessibility.
During a recent dialogue with the MEC for Roads and Transport, Kedibone Diale, the potential for a new bus route emerged as a viable solution—but its success hinges on community demand. “It’s crucial that we show the authorities there is a genuine need for this route,” Nt’sekhe emphasized, pointing out that public transportation can significantly ease the daily commute for residents, making travel more efficient and sustainable.
The proposed bus route aims to not only facilitate easier access to Rhodesfield but also to alleviate pressure on local transportation systems by encouraging more residents to use public transport. In an age where eco-friendliness and sustainable travel are at the forefront, this initiative aligns perfectly with broader efforts to reduce congestion and pollution in urban areas.
As part of this community engagement, Nt’sekhe has launched a petition for residents to support the initiative. By signing the petition, community members can voice their desire for enhanced public transportation services, ultimately speeding up the implementation process. “Every signature counts,” she stated, urging everyone to take part in this vital push for improved transport options.
